Hi All, this is probably the easiest question in the world.
I have drawn a circle and want to centre everything to the middle of that circle. is there an easy way to
1) find the exact middle of the circle and
2) set up a tab or marker that will snap things onto it

Thanks in advance

David.
 
You could just lock the postion of the circle and then select one or more objects plus tthe circle. Open the Align palette and click first on horizontal align center and then on vertical align center

Using OSX 10.3.9 on a G4
 
A few ways:

1. Use the Align palette.
2. Turn on Smart Guides (they'll show the center point of the circle).
3. Make a copy of the circle, right-click on it and choose Make Guides (you can set objects to snap to guides).
